It’s the late great Carrie Fisher’s birthday, as the Star Wars icon and prolific writer would have turned 68 today. Fisher is obviously best known for playing Princess Leia, but her long list of acting credits also includes the “Mystery Woman” from The Blues Brothers, Marie from When Harry Met Sally and “Bianca Burnette,” the washed-up actress who accuses George Lucas of sexual misconduct in Scream 3.
Less high up on Fisher’s list of accomplishments is the 1981 comedy Under the Rainbow, a notorious turd about the making of The Wizard of Oz, also starring Chevy Chase. Inspired by possibly apocryphal stories involving the hotel hosting the “drunken” Munchkin actors, Under the Rainbow also threw in a wacky espionage plot line about Nazi spies, which is why Hitler gets heil-ed in the balls just five minutes into the movie.

ABC’s Deception wrapped its one-and-done run on Sunday with a two-hour finale that finally shed more light on Mystery Woman’s agenda, before setting the stage for what would have been a quite different Season 2.
The opening hour revealed that the stolen Lynx diamond was but one of several artifacts belonging to Corvus Vale members, who years ago entrusted Alistair Black with masterfully safeguarding their fortunes. He did so by way of a secret room that was accessed via a stairwell hidden beneath the trunk young Johnny would get locked in for one of their tricks.

Kellie Martin knows there isn't much she hasn't played.
From her initial television stardom as teenager Becca on ABC's "Life Goes On," through a long string of TV movies and onto later series roles as the Appalachian teacher on CBS' "Christy," medical student Lucy on NBC's "ER" and an amateur sleuth in Hallmark Channel's "Mystery Woman" franchise, the actress has covered a lot of turf.
Any type of part Martin hasn't done already holds special appeal for her now. That's a big reason she has joined Lifetime's Sunday-night drama "Army Wives" as Capt. Nicole Galassini, whose expertise on African geopolitics proves useful.
"When they called me and I listened to the pitch about the character, I was so excited," Martin tells Zap2it. "I've never played military, after 30 years of being an actress, and the thing I love so much about Nicole is that she's so smart and so driven.

Television personality Leeza Gibbons recently participated in the planting of 100 trees at Beverly Hills' Coldwater Canyon Park to counteract the carbon footprint imprinted by each guest at her yearly Oscar viewing party "A Night to Make a Difference". The April 16 event was held in cooperation with environmental nonprofits Environmental Media Association (Ema) and Tree People.
With the planting of trees native to Southern California, Leeza met both a promise to offset carbon emissions and to continue her fundraising contributions to local nonprofit organizations. Through the efforts of the Leeza Gibbons Memory Foundation and extensive celebrity involvement, numerous groundbreaking charities have received critical financial support.
Leeza's partnership with Tree People and Ema is one piece of the growing crusade to inform the environmental consciousness of the entertainment community and motivate Hollywood's influential leaders to take up the cause. Kenin re-ups at Hallmark Channel
Hallmark Channel executive vp programming David Kenin has extended his contract by two years.
Crown Media Holdings, which owns and operates the network, disclosed Tuesday in a fil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ission that Kenin's contract will now expire Dec. 31, 2009.
In addition, Kenin's annual base salary will increase to $825,000 next year 2008 and $850,000 in 2009.
Hallmark Channel has been on a roll with its programming, seeing solid numbers for acquired movies like March of the Penguins as well as its original movies, including the mystery franchises Mystery Woman, Jane Doe, Murder 101 and McBride.
